Adding service charge to sales price for VAT purpose but no service tax charged
I run a travel agency in Dubai specialising in booking air tickets. As of now, we are doing ticket sales by adding our commission/service charge to the purchase price. But are not charging any service tax to the customer. Are we doing the right thing?

0 LikeInternational transport of goods and services is zero rated as per UAE VAT Law.It states that all services supplied wrt international transport of goods and services are zero rated. Therefore the service with regard to purchase of international air ticket is zero rated.
0 LikeIn your case, sale of international air tickets and related services are zero rated. Local travel packages and tourism etc is standard rated. For partial zero rating make one invoice and charge vat on your service charges
